Set di caratteri

Salve io sto effetuando dei test di migarzione da db access '97 a mysql e mi sono accorto che il  set di caratteri č importantissimo per mantenere l'integrita dei dati contenuti senza laterazioni di ogni tipo.

Dai test che ho effettuato utilizzando i seguenti set di caratteri:

  • utf8_general_ci

- Nel UTF8 ho potuto notare che i caratteri accentati tipo la "ą" venivano alterate.

  • lantin1_general_ci

- Nel Lantin1 ho potuto notare che i caratteri speciali tipo la  " ' " veniva convertito in ?

[/list]

Qualcuno sa consigliarmi un set di caratteri che non alteri il contenuto dei dati durante la migrazione di suddetti dati sul nuovo db?

Ringrazio anticipatamente per la disponibilitą.  :bye:       

inviato 10 anni fa
EKELON77
X 0 X

Forse il problema non č nei set di caratteri che stai utilizzando ma č causato dalle diverse "lingue" parlata dai vari software interessati nella migrazione.

Come stai effettuando il passaggio?

risposto 10 anni fa
Gianni Tomasicchio
X 0 X

Con il Tool  che mette a disposizione MySql per la migrazione dalle diverse base dati (ULTIMA VERSIONE).

Cmq. prima mi creo un dump con la struttura del db dove iserisco anche il set di caratteri e lo eseguo da phpMyAdmin facendo l'import sql che poi crea il db e dopo effettuo la migrazione con il tool di MySql, forse devo passarci qualche parametro?   O0

risposto 10 anni fa
EKELON77
X 0 X

Non č possibile fare tutto con il programma di MySQL?

risposto 10 anni fa
Gianni Tomasicchio
X 0 X

Si potrei fare tutto con il programma di MySQL, ma incontrei sicuramente dei problemi nella definizione del formato delle tabelle tra la conversione Access a MySql per il tipo di formato data/ora per quanto riguarda Access quando nei campi delle tabelle in riferimento alla DataProt viene inserito solo la "data" ed invece per OraProt viene inserito a volte solo l'"ora".

Per questo ho dovuto creare un dump della struttura del db definendo le tabelle ed i campi come ho detto nelle precedenti conversazioni cercando di utilizzare un set di caratteri che non alterasse il contenuto dei dati, penso che non sia il fatto che MySql č nativamente in lingua inglese. ???

risposto 10 anni fa
EKELON77
X 0 X

Si potrei fare tutto con il programma di MySQL, ma incontrei sicuramente dei problemi nella definizione del formato delle tabelle tra la conversione Access a MySql per il tipo di formato data/ora per quanto riguarda Access quando nei campi delle tabelle in riferimento alla DataProt viene inserito solo la "data" ed invece per OraProt viene inserito a volte solo l'"ora".

Per questo ho dovuto creare un dump della struttura del db definendo le tabelle ed i campi come ho detto nelle precedenti conversazioni cercando di utilizzare un set di caratteri che non alterasse il contenuto dei dati, penso che non sia il fatto che MySql č nativamente in lingua inglese. ???

Come posso fare utilizzando soltanto il tool di MySQL? :bye: :angel:

risposto 10 anni fa
EKELON77
X 0 X
Effettua l'accesso o registrati per rispondere a questa domanda